Constructing a cement pad in Edison, NJ is a practical solution for creating a durable and stable surface for various uses, such as patios, driveways, or foundations for sheds. Understanding the cost involved can help homeowners budget effectively and make informed decisions.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Pad: Larger pads require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Thickness of the Pad: Thicker pads use more concrete, which can drive up the price.
- Site Preparation: Costs can vary depending on the need for excavation, leveling, and clearing debris.
- Type of Concrete: Different grades and mixes of concrete can affect the price.
- Reinforcement Materials: The use of rebar or wire mesh for added strength can increase costs.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Edison, NJ can impact the overall expense.
- Permits and Inspections: Fees for permits and required inspections can add to the total cost.
- Additional Features: Adding features like decorative finishes, staining, or stamping will increase the c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Edison, NJ) |
---|---|
Site Preparation | $500 - $1,200 |
Concrete Pad Installation | $4 - $8 per sq. ft. |
Reinforcement Materials | $1 - $3 per sq. ft. |
Finishing (staining/stamping) | $2 - $5 per sq. ft. |
Permits and Inspections | $200 - $500 |
